Product Overview and Core Features
Produced using a wet-forming method, fiberglass air filter paper is crafted from glass microfiber wool, resulting in a material with uniformly distributed fibers. This unique structure ensures high dust-hold capacity, low air resistance, and exceptional mechanical strength. The product is categorized into three primary series based on filtration efficiency: ASHRAE, HEPA, and ULPA, each tailored for specific applications.
The ASHRAE series (F5–F9) is designed for general-purpose air conditioning systems, while the HEPA series (H10–H14) caters to high-grade cleanrooms and specialized equipment. The ULPA series (U15–U17) offers ultra-high efficiency for semiconductor manufacturing and other precision industries. This classification ensures that users can select the optimal filter grade for their specific needs.



Technical Specifications and Performance Metrics
The following table provides a detailed overview of the fiberglass air filter paper technical specifications, including efficiency, weight, thickness, and resistance values:
| Classification | Grade | Efficiency (%) | Basic Weight (g/m²) | Thickness (mm) @100kPa | Air Resistance (Pa) @5.3cm/s | Tensile Strength (N/m) MD | Stiffness (mg) MD | |
|---|---|---|---|---|---|---|---|---|
| Minimum | Maximum | |||||||
| ASHRAE | FY-F9 | 95 | 70 | 0.34 | 55±10 | 1200 | 1200 | 1200 |
| FY-F8 | 90 | 70 | 0.34 | 35±5 | 1200 | 1200 | 1200 | |
| FY-F7 | 80 | 70 | 0.34 | 33±5 | 1200 | 1200 | 1200 | |
| FY-F6 | 60 | 70 | 0.33 | 20±5 | 1200 | 1200 | 1200 | |
| HEPA | FY-H14 | 99.995 | 70 | 0.34 | 340±20 | 1200 | 1200 | 1000 |
| FY-H13 | 99.97 | 70 | 0.34 | 290±20 | 1200 | 1200 | 1000 | |
| FY-H12 | 99.8 | 70 | 0.34 | 250±20 | 1200 | 1200 | 1000 | |
| FY-H11 | 98 | 70 | 0.34 | 120±20 | 1200 | 1200 | 1000 | |
| FY-H10 | 94 | 70 | 0.34 | 80±15 | 1200 | 1200 | 1000 | |
| ULPA | FY-U17 | 99.9999 | 73 | 0.37 | 500±20 | 1200 | 1200 | 1000 |
| FY-U16 | 99.9999 | 73 | 0.37 | 440±20 | 1200 | 1200 | 1000 | |
| FY-U15 | 99.999 | 73 | 0.37 | 390±20 | 1200 | 1200 | 1000 | |
Key Advantages of Fiberglass Air Filter Paper
The fiberglass air filter paper offers several distinct advantages:
- High Dust-Hold Capacity: The uniform fiber distribution allows for efficient particulate retention, reducing the frequency of filter replacements.
- Low Air Resistance: Optimized design minimizes pressure drop, ensuring energy efficiency in HVAC systems.
- Excellent Mechanical Strength: The material maintains structural integrity under varying operational conditions.
- Customizable Efficiency: With grades ranging from ASHRAE F5 to ULPA U17, the product adapts to diverse filtration needs.
Applications Across Industries
This air filter paper is utilized in a wide range of applications, including:
- Home and Commercial HVAC Systems: Enhancing indoor air quality in residential and office environments.
- Industrial Air Purifiers: Removing contaminants in manufacturing and processing facilities.
- Photographic Film Manufacturing: Maintaining particle-free environments for sensitive processes.
- Microelectronics Production: Protecting delicate components from airborne particles.
- Pharmaceutical Processing: Ensuring compliance with stringent cleanroom standards.
- Chip Manufacturing: Critical for ultra-clean environments in semiconductor fabrication.
